Welcome aboard. Driftnet is our orphaned-resource sweeper: it scans the Bellhaven clusters nightly and deletes volumes, load balancers, and snapshots with no owning deployment. Because it holds delete permissions, every release must carry signed provenance. The attestation covers the source revision, the builder identity, and the dependency lockfile digest. Never run a Driftnet binary whose provenance you haven't verified yourself — a tampered sweeper could delete live resources. Start by checking the release against the token below.

build token for yajof-bajof: htk31_506ff1188f74596b5bb2eec94edc43c

## Runbook: User module split (Project Tanglewood)

We're mid-split: the user module now lives in its own service (Userling), but the old monolith still proxies a few endpoints. If you're on call and logins are failing, check the proxy first — it's usually the shim, not Userling itself. Flip the fallback flag only as a last resort. The shim starts with these values.

service settings:
[casax]
port = 6379
team = rusir
host = casax.zemvarhq.corp
region = outer-4
access_code = ac_9808ce
timeout_ms = 1500

Handover — guest Wi-Fi desk, Vantrell House reception. Tablet stays docked; charge overnight. Guest vouchers print from the grey terminal only — restart it if the queue stalls. Log every voucher in the binder, no exceptions. Spare cables in drawer two. If the portal drops, call the Helm IT line before lunch; after that it's best-effort. Marika left laminated instructions under the keyboard. The terminal cupboard behind the desk is locked; to open it use the code below.

door code, kawip-bagap: bdg-HQEWH-4